Personality: Ora is a hardened woman through and through. A cold, harsh and gritty woman. She believes in tough love to an extent even nature would wince at, purposefully making things harsher and putting pressure on others so that they will overcome and strengthen. In this way, she has a sort of soft-side, which is to say she is much colder to people she likes because she feels that it is then his duty to make them stronger. To Ora, power and pride are everything. She Values only those who are useful in combat of any way and sticks to the ancient ways of Mandalorians. This makes her easily provoked and believe that murder is an ok option in any conflict. She is very honor bound as well. Bio: Early into Ora's life, her father was adopted into the storm trooper army and mysteriously vanished in their ranks. Ora was left with a mother who alone could not pay for them to live well and because of so their relationship strained. An already heartbroken Ora was left with an increasingly stressful life. It was then that the deathwatch, a small fringe group hoping to return Mandalore to its previous warrior code caught up to her. They taunted Ora with honor and promises of meeting her father again in the heavens. This easily swayed her to their side and so she was fitted with the armor, jetpack, and blasters of a true Mandalorian warrior. After school, she would spend all of her time training with them over and over, during time off she would sleep the night, anything to strengthen herself. She was only 16 when they felt she was trained enough to be sent to her first mission. It ended in a massacre, the destruction of a halfway house. Over the course of years, she would grow stronger and as would her cause. With the threat of the new order, however, their cause changed. They viewed the threat of assimilation into an empire far worse than the appropriation of diplomacy and as such she and her group took up arms with the rebellion. Her risky maneuvers won her value and rank at the expense of her body. battle after battle she lost a piece of herself but do to proving so useful she was repaired and sent back to battle. Eventually, she was captured and detained before she was capable of ending her own life. With her pride destroyed and her group turning their back to her thanks to this crushing failure to commit to the end, Ora now hopes to escape and get her revenge against the new order so that she may redeem herself.
